§ 29.515 - Are there any exceptions to those actions?

The Secretary of Commerce may waive with respect to a particular award, in writing, a suspension of payments under an award, suspension or termination of an award, or suspension or debarment of a recipient if the Secretary of Commerce determines that such a waiver would be in the public interest. This exception authority cannot be delegated to any other official.
